Explanatory note

(This note is not part of the Regulations)

EXPLANATORY NOTE

These Regulations amend the Workmen’s Compensation (Supplementation)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 1983 by increasing the lower rates of lesser incapacity allowance consequential upon the increase in the maximum rate of that allowance made by the Social Security Benefits Up-rating Order (Northern Ireland) 2007. The Regulations also include transitional and revocation provisions.
